CAD输入法自动切换助手 - 说明文档

CAD Auto IME | 技术文档 (v0.3 版 )

🎉 恭喜!安装部署已完成

系统提示:CAD 输入法自动切换助手底层运行库已成功部署至你的计算机系统。

📌 安装顺序防呆提示:本插件属于底层注册表注入组件。请务必先安装并运行过至少一次 AutoCAD,然后再安装本插件。若你重装或升级了 AutoCAD,请将本插件卸载后重新安装一次,以便重新写入加载引导。

📌 桌面快捷方式:仅为你方便查阅本说明文档而创建,可根据个人使用习惯随时删除,绝不影响程序核心功能的正常后台运行

🎯 产品概述

🔹 产品定位

CAD Auto IME 是一款专为工程设计领域打造的底层系统级效率增强组件。v0.3 版 融合了双擎状态机锁与底层焦点雷达,彻底消灭了绘图卡顿与输入法误杀,真正实现了 0 延迟的无感输入法切换体验。

🔹 解决的核心问题

使用场景 传统操作方式 (含旧版插件) 本工具解决方案 (v0.3 版)
日常绘图 (快捷菜单弹出) 极易因为弹窗抢走焦点被误切成中文 ✅ 状态锁+黑名单雷达,画线(PL)等弹窗时死锁英文,绝不误判
各种文本与图块标注 经常因层级问题导致输入法无法呼出 ✅ Win32 底层 API 穿透嵌套界面,精准捕获打字光标瞬间切中文
多图纸切换 (MDI) 图纸 A 的中文状态会污染图纸 B ✅ 独立生命周期隔离,切回图纸瞬间自动“洗牌”重置为英文
长时间高负荷绘图 后台频繁监听导致鼠标有轻微顿挫感 ✅ 极客级内存复用优化,彻底消灭 GC 垃圾回收造成的掉帧微卡顿

⚡ v0.3 版核心特性

本次版本迎来了史诗级架构跃迁,让插件兼具稳健与智能:

1. 🧠 双擎状态锁:0 误杀防御网

我们将“命令状态”与“焦点弹窗”深度结合。只要你执行的不是白名单里的文字命令,底层就会挂上一把“死锁”,即使界面弹出一万个下拉菜单抢占焦点,插件也绝对不会切出中文。而在使用天正、源泉等图块重命名插件时,则秒切中文。

2. 🖥️ 全透明双区平权 UX 与无感交互

彻底抛弃“黑盒”逻辑。现在的配置面板中,所有 AutoCAD 核心文字命令(如 TEXT, MTEXT, BLOCK, LAYER 等 28 个)与外挂命令完全透明可见。搭配极简的“双击删除”与底部 Toast 无感文字提示,交互体验如丝般顺滑。

3. 💊 零配置自愈升级机制

插件内置了智能向下兼容探针。如果你是从老版本升级上来的用户,程序在后台启动时会瞬间发现你的配置文件缺失了新功能指令,并以纳秒级速度静默为你修补完整。你什么都不用做,即刻享受满血体验。

4. 🚀 跨世代架构引擎 (兼容 CAD2007~2027)

底层核心经过全面重构,向下兼容至 .NET 3.5 时代的老爷机,向上完美适配未来采用 .NET 10.0 的 AutoCAD 2027,真正做到“全宇宙版本通杀”。

📖 使用指南与命令

💡 极简操作提示:经过大量测试,本版的本程序自带97个内置命令,包括 46 个 CAD 原生系统命令和 51 个常用插件命令。你可以直接上手画图,如果发现有极个别自定 LISP 没有切中文,再使用下方命令添加即可。

⚠️ 添加自定义命令的铁律:必须输入“命令全称”!
当你在配置面板中添加自己的扩展命令时,严禁输入快捷键(Alias)(例如画圆不要输 C,创建块不要输 B)。
你必须输入 CAD 底部命令行执行时的真实全称(例如:CIRCLEBLOCKTBLKNAME 等),否则系统底层将无法匹配触发!

🔹 1. 呼出白名单配置面板

在 CAD 命令行输入:👉 CUSTOMAUTOIME

功能:直观管理所有文字、标注指令。支持 Ctrl+Z 撤销,Ctrl+Y 重做,以及双击/Delete 一键防呆删除。

🔹 2. 临时开启/关闭助手

在 CAD 命令行输入:👉 TOGGLEAUTOIME

功能:一键全局切换插件的运行状态(开启/关闭监控)。

💻 支持的 AutoCAD 版本

版本代号 官方版本 架构/框架要求 支持状态
AutoCAD 2007~2014 R17.0 ~ R19.1 32/64 位 (.NET 2~4) ✅ 完全支持
AutoCAD 2015~2024 R20.0 ~ R24.3 64 位 (.NET 4.x) ✅ 完全支持
AutoCAD 2025 R25.0 64 位 (.NET 8.0) 全面适配
AutoCAD 2026 R25.1 64 位 (.NET 9.0) 全面适配
AutoCAD 2027 R26.0 64 位 (.NET 10.0) 前瞻性支持

❓ 常见问题

Q1:我可以把面板下方的 TEXT、MTEXT 等系统内置指令删掉吗?

A强烈建议保留! 它们是维持 AutoCAD 正常文字录入的核心骨干。虽然我们将控制权完全交给了你(允许你强行删除),但删除后,这些命令将不再自动切换输入法。如果误删,请点击面板下方的【恢复默认】按钮一键重置。

Q2:程序会影响 AutoCAD 运行速度、引起掉帧卡顿吗?

A:绝对不会。本次 v0.3 版本彻底消灭了高频拦截带来的垃圾回收(GC)压力,通过底层内存 Buffer 复用机制,对 CPU 和帧率的影响严格为 0。哪怕连续画图 10 小时,鼠标依然顺滑如初。

🗑️ 卸载流程

本程序提供极其纯净的卸载体验,不留任何系统垃圾。

  1. 打开 Windows 「开始菜单」,找到 「CAD Auto Ime」 程序组。
  2. 点击 「卸载 CAD 输入法助手」
  3. (注:为确保彻底清除注册表占用,卸载时若 CAD 正在运行,程序会提示你保存图纸并自动关闭 CAD 进程)。

📝 版本历史

🚀 v0.3 (阶段性-终版) - 本次更新

📦 v0.2.2 (数据流双擎版)

📦 v0.2.1 / v0.2.0 (热修复与重构版)

📦 v0.1.0 (初创版)

📮 联系与反馈

作者信息

作者 Yang Jun [浅醉·墨语] Andy_127
技术定位 兴趣爱好,交流分享
开发理念 用最底层的技术解决最实际的问题,让设计更专注
意见反馈 📱 【浅醉·墨语】_Andy_127